Ongoing attacks against Office 365Identified as CVE-2021-40444, the security issue affects Windows Server 2008 through 2019 and Windows 8.1 through 10 and has a severity level of 8.8 out of the maximum 10.\n\nMicrosoft is aware of targeted attacks that try to exploit the vulnerability by sending specially-crafted Microsoft Office documents to potential victims, the company says in an advisory\u00a0today.\n\u201cAn attacker could craft a malicious ActiveX control to be used by a Microsoft Office document that hosts the browser rendering engine. The attacker would then have to convince the user to open the malicious document\u201d \u2013 Microsoft\nHowever, the attack is thwarted if Microsoft Office runs with the default configuration, where documents from the web are opened in Protected View mode or Application Guard for Office 365.\n\nProtected View is a read-only mode that has most of the editing functions disabled, while Application Guard isolates untrusted documents, denying them access to corporate resources, the intranet, or other files on the system.\n\nSystems with active Microsoft\u2019s Defender Antivirus and Defender for Endpoint (build 1.349.22.0 and above) benefit from protection against attempts to exploit CVE-2021-40444.\n\nMicrosoft\u2019s enterprise security platform will display alerts about this attack as \u201cSuspicious Cpl File Execution.\u201d\nSee Also: Complete Offensive Security and Ethical Hacking Course Researchers from multiple cybersecurity companies are credited for finding and reporting the vulnerability: Haifei Li of EXPMON, Dhanesh Kizhakkinan, Bryce Abdo, and Genwei Jiang \u2013 all three\u00a0of Mandiant, and Rick Cole of Microsoft Security Intelligence.\n\nIn a tweet today, EXPMON (exploit monitor)\u00a0says that they found the vulnerability after detecting a \u201chighly sophisticated zero-day attack\u201d aimed at Microsoft Office users.\nhttps://www.bleepstatic.com/images/news/u/1100723/2021/EXPMONBug-40444.jpg \n&lt;figcaptionsource: EXPMON \nEXPMON researchers reproduced the attack on the latest\u00a0Office 2019 / Office 365 on Windows 10.\n\nIn a reply to BleepingComputer, Haifei Li\u00a0of EXPMON said that the attackers used a .DOCX file. Upon opening it, the document loaded the Internet Explorer engine to render a remote web page from the threat actor.\n\nMalware is then downloaded by using a specific ActiveX control in the web page. Executing the threat is done using \u201ca trick called \u2018Cpl File Execution\u2019,\u201d referenced in Microsoft\u2019s advisory.\n\nThe researcher told us that the attack method is 100% reliable, which makes it very dangerous.
